aboutsummaryrefslogtreecommitdiff
path: root/devel/lua-bitlib
diff options
context:
space:
mode:
authorRong-En Fan <rafan@FreeBSD.org>2008-01-10 15:53:23 +0000
committerRong-En Fan <rafan@FreeBSD.org>2008-01-10 15:53:23 +0000
commit5f799a0efb0b87b6c5bdd54f33dcf5d5558ca731 (patch)
tree7664fb651a7363d48ac71b7106e7eeb2e644888f /devel/lua-bitlib
parent2b2fb75b92741358a6a74a382b3c4ee01a7eaad8 (diff)
downloadports-5f799a0efb0b87b6c5bdd54f33dcf5d5558ca731.tar.gz
ports-5f799a0efb0b87b6c5bdd54f33dcf5d5558ca731.zip
Notes
Diffstat (limited to 'devel/lua-bitlib')
-rw-r--r--devel/lua-bitlib/Makefile29
-rw-r--r--devel/lua-bitlib/distinfo3
-rw-r--r--devel/lua-bitlib/pkg-descr3
3 files changed, 35 insertions, 0 deletions
diff --git a/devel/lua-bitlib/Makefile b/devel/lua-bitlib/Makefile
new file mode 100644
index 000000000000..3775728eda2c
--- /dev/null
+++ b/devel/lua-bitlib/Makefile
@@ -0,0 +1,29 @@
+# New ports collection makefile for: lua-bitlib
+# Date created: 07 Jan 2008
+# Whom: Rong-En Fan <rafan@FreeBSD.org>
+#
+# $FreeBSD$
+#
+
+PORTNAME= bitlib
+PORTVERSION= 24
+CATEGORIES= devel
+MASTER_SITES= http://luaforge.net/frs/download.php/2715/
+PKGNAMEPREFIX= ${LUA_PKGNAMEPREFIX}
+
+MAINTAINER= rafan@FreeBSD.org
+COMMENT= A tiny library for bitwise operations
+
+USE_LUA= 5.0+
+
+PLIST_FILES= %%LUA_MODLIBDIR%%/bit.so
+
+do-build:
+ cd ${WRKSRC} && \
+ ${CC} -fPIC -shared -o bit.so lbitlib.c \
+ ${LUA_LIBDIR}/liblua.a -I${LUA_INCDIR} -lm
+
+do-install:
+ @${INSTALL_PROGRAM} ${WRKSRC}/bit.so ${LUA_MODLIBDIR}
+
+.include <bsd.port.mk>
diff --git a/devel/lua-bitlib/distinfo b/devel/lua-bitlib/distinfo
new file mode 100644
index 000000000000..319794846f1b
--- /dev/null
+++ b/devel/lua-bitlib/distinfo
@@ -0,0 +1,3 @@
+MD5 (bitlib-24.tar.gz) = aa7e614e8a4a3d384bdcb9b7d06fb002
+SHA256 (bitlib-24.tar.gz) = 42d3a84b031192a8f143e720483cd813528a01719b84632cc6ef6267f838a2b9
+SIZE (bitlib-24.tar.gz) = 303706
diff --git a/devel/lua-bitlib/pkg-descr b/devel/lua-bitlib/pkg-descr
new file mode 100644
index 000000000000..17020552d1f5
--- /dev/null
+++ b/devel/lua-bitlib/pkg-descr
@@ -0,0 +1,3 @@
+bitlib is a tiny library for bitwise operations.
+
+WWW: http://luaforge.net/projects/bitlib/